#ef68f3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ef68f3 is composed of 93.7% red, 40.8%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 57.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 298.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 68%. #ef68f3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0ff with #df00e7. Closest websafe color is: #ff66ff.

#ef68f3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ef68f3 has RGB values of R:239, G:104,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15689971.
